Amerigon Announces Trading Symbol Change
    IRWINDALE, Calif. - Amerigon Incorporated announced today that effective at 
the opening of trading on Wednesday, June 21, 2000, Amerigon Common Stock will 
trade on The Nasdaq SmallCap Market under the new symbol "ARGN."  The Common 
Stock has been trading on The Nasdaq SmallCap Market under the symbol "ARGNA."

    At the Annual Meeting of Shareholders held on May 24, 2000, Amerigon
shareholders approved an amendment to the Articles of Incorporation that
eliminated the Class B Common Stock, which was no longer being used by the
Company.  As a result, the Class A Common Stock has been renamed "Common
Stock" and the trading symbol of the Common Stock is being changed from
"ARGNA" to "ARGN."

    Amerigon, an emerging player in the global automotive industry, develops
and markets proprietary products for automotive OEMs.  Its proprietary Climate
Control Seat(TM) (CCS(TM)) technology provides active heating and cooling for
seat occupants and has debuted in the 2000 Lincoln Navigator.  The Company's
other products include its AmeriGuard(TM) radar sensor systems designed to
extend the driver's field of view in such vehicle applications as enhanced
parking aids, back-up warning systems and side object detection.
